Former Vice President,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ia, has won the New Patriotic Party (NPP) presidential primary in the Northern, Savannah and North East regions.
Delegates across the three regions overwhelmingly voted for Dr. Bawumia as the NPP’s presidential candidate for the 2028 election.
Northern Region
Dr. Bawumia secured 9,272 votes, defeating Dr. Bryan Acheampong, who garnered 1,594 votes; Kennedy Ohene Agyapong, 811; Dr. Yaw Osei Adutwum, 88; and Kwabena Agyei Agyepong 42.
Savannah Region
Dr. Bawumia polled 2,863 votes, ahead of Dr. Bryan Acheampong, 552; Kennedy Ohene Agyapong, 403; Dr. Yaw Osei Adutwum, 32; and Kwabena Agyei Agyepong, 13.
North East Region
Dr. Bawumia secured 3,227 votes, with Kennedy Ohene Agyapong polling 169; Dr. Bryan Acheampong, 103; Dr. Yaw Osei Adutwum, 14; and Kwabena Agyei Agyepong, 8.
Delegates from the Northern, Savannah and North East regions said they believe Dr. Bawumia is the most marketable and experienced candidate to help the NPP regain power from the ruling National Democratic Congress (NDC) in the 2028 general election.
